#e4a9f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4a9f8 is composed of 89.4% red, 66.3%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.1% cyan, 31.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 284.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 81.8%. #e4a9f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c953f1.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

● #e4a9f8 color description : Very soft violet.
#e4a9f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4a9f8 has RGB values of R:228, G:169,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 14985720.
